Output 312803c97532f9b76fec83485691f06cbf7ee494480f1a3fa9be1787119a542a:41

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 357e797ab8c9e12748ced61d0d0260a251e14120fd8a269240b9a13d1b6d25e6
address
bc1px4l8j74ce8sjwjxw6cws6qnq5fg7zsfqlk9zdyjqhxsn6xmdyhnq8dnhcn
transaction
312803c97532f9b76fec83485691f06cbf7ee494480f1a3fa9be1787119a542a
spent
true